Output 33db70e84c0b40345898d32e8a7bdf224f5916872a72ed7c5e3a143d7943587d:7

value
51847989
script pubkey
OP_0 OP_PUSHBYTES_20 dc38939da84eac4ec67a8f520126a4f3d7d9252b
address
ltc1qmsuf88dgf6kya3n63afqzf4y70tajfftlp6ha9
transaction
33db70e84c0b40345898d32e8a7bdf224f5916872a72ed7c5e3a143d7943587d
spent
true